Bioidentical Hormone Therapy
Bioidentical Hormone Therapy (BHRT) includes the use of naturally derived hormones to balance and support hormonal systems in the body. BHRT is always individualized to the patient’s unique set of symptoms and dosing is based on laboratory investigations. Commonly prescribed hormones include progesterone, estrogen, testosterone, DHEA, pregnenolone and natural dessicated thyroid hormone. These are either given orally or through a compounded cream, which is applied to the skin for optimal absorption.
A patient may have several symptoms to indicate the need for hormone therapy, such as:
- Menopausal symptoms: hot flashes, insomnia, vaginal dryness, mood mood swings, fatigue
- Pre-menstrual symptoms: abdominal cramping, breast tenderness, mood swings, fatigue, acne
- Menstrual irregularities: heavy periods, irregular periods, abdominal cramps
- Men’s health concerns: inability to lose fat or gain muscle, erectile dysfunction, low libido
- Underactive thyroid function: fatigue, weight gain/inability to lose weight, constipation, hair loss, dry skin, cold intolerance, thinning hair
- Adrenal insufficiency: high stress, anxiety, fatigue, insomnia, abdominal weight gain
- Known hormonal imbalances
Bioidentical Hormones are biologically identical to our body’s own hormones, therefore allowing for them to be well recognized and accepted by hormone receptors in the body. Comparatively, conventionally prescribed hormone replacement therapy (HRT) is a synthetic form meant to mimic our body’s own hormones, but are not biologically identical. Conventional HRT therapies are used to treat a myriad of hormonal dysfunctions in menopause, such as hot flashes, vaginal dryness, sleep disturbances, mood swings, and to protect against menopause-related risk of cardiovascular disease and osteoporosis. The synthetic HRT forms come with some disadvantages, including an increased risk of developing breast cancer, cardiovascular disease, blood clots and strokes.
